# Compacting a vector of any length with or without names Compacting a vector of any length with or without names ## Usage ``` r compact_vec(data, nm.sep = ": ", val.sep = "; ") ``` ## Arguments - data: vector, optionally named - nm.sep: string separating name from value if any - val.sep: string separating values ## Value character string ## Examples ``` r sample(seq_len(4), 20, TRUE) |> as_factor() |> named_levels() |> sort() |> compact_vec() #> [1] "1: 1; 2: 2; 3: 3; 4: 4" 1:6 |> compact_vec() #> [1] "1; 2; 3; 4; 5; 6" "test" |> compact_vec() #> [1] "test" sample(letters[1:9], 20, TRUE) |> compact_vec() #> [1] "g; e; d; a; c; g; a; f; g; h; f; a; d; b; f; e; c; d; f; b" ```
